Our Internal Audit & Health Check Services

We offer detailed internal audits for a range of ISO management systems to ensure compliance and readiness.

ISO 9001 QMS Audit

Verify that your Quality Management System meets all ISO 9001 requirements, ensuring process efficiency, customer satisfaction, and a foundation for continual improvement.

ISO 14001 EMS Audit

Assess your Environmental Management System for compliance with ISO 14001, focusing on environmental impact, regulatory adherence, and sustainability goals.

ISO 45001 OHS Audit

Evaluate your Occupational Health & Safety management system against ISO 45001 to ensure a safe working environment and minimize workplace incidents.

ISO 22000 FSMS Audit

Conduct a thorough audit of your Food Safety Management System to identify and control food safety hazards, ensuring compliance with ISO 22000.

ISO 17025 Lab Audit

Review your laboratory's technical competence, quality system, and testing procedures to ensure they align with the stringent ISO 17025 standard.

System Health Checks

Perform a high-level gap analysis or pre-assessment of your management system to identify key areas for improvement before a formal certification audit.

Frequently Asked Questions

What does a management system internal auditor do?

An internal auditor systematically reviews an organization's management system (like ISO 9001 or ISO 14001) to verify it conforms to the standard's requirements and the company's own policies. They gather objective evidence by reviewing documents, interviewing staff, and observing processes. The goal is to identify non-conformities and opportunities for improvement, ensuring the system is effective and ready for an external certification audit.
